  • WezVWezV Frets: 16629
    edited August 2014

    Otherwise I heartily approve of bonkers multi stringed instruments
    so do i really, and an extended range fanned fret isn't really that usual a request - although some of the extra detail in this makes it particularly crazy

    I would struggle to do 48 frets though, especially as that only leave 2.6 mm between the 47th and 48th fret slot on the treble side, once the wire is in it would be about 1.5mm with tiny mandolin fretwire

    good luck to anyone that tries it!
